A:AnswerThe motherboard only supports PC4-17000 (DDR4-2133) memory, from what I have read the memory you asked about will work just not at its optimal speed since it wont utilize the 2666 potential.

A:AnswerTommiegun97,
It is possible to upgrade to an i7 processor, according to HP's website this motherboard is compatible with one i7 processor (i7-7700 to be specific). Newer and previous versions are not compatible with the pin setting and socket type. https://support.hp.com/us-en/product/omen-by-hp-870-200/13687063/model/15741160/document/c05389962
